Your Key Responsibilities:

  1. Act as the 2IC (Second-in-Charge) to support and collaborate with the Centre Director in the day-to-day running of the centre
  2. Provide mentorship and guidance to educators, promoting professional growth and excellence in teaching practices
  3. Lead and support room teams as a Team Leader, fostering strong relationships with children, families, and staff
  4. Float across various rooms to offer leadership, drive consistency, and ensure smooth daily operations
  5. Engage in non-contact time to focus on centre management tasks, including rostering, team development, and compliance
  6. Assist with performance management and fostering a positive workplace culture
  7. Be a go-to resource and support for both the Centre Director and the entire team
